Come join the fun as students take a submarine bus on a field trip to explore the ocean deep, in this wordless picture book from the creator of Field Trip to the Moon!
Students dressed in deep sea helmets travel to the ocean deep in a yellow school-bus submarine. When they get there, they frolic with fish, chase luminescent squid, and discover an old shipwreck.
But when it's time to return to the submarine bus, one student lingers to take a photo of a treasure chest and falls into a deep ravine. Luckily, the child makes an unexpected friend-- a maybe-not-so-extinct sea creature called a Pleiosaur- that's happy to entertain the young explorer until the teacher returns.
In his follow-up to Field Trip to the Moon, John Hare's rich, atmospheric art in this wordless picture book invites all children to imagine themselves in the story- a tale full of mysteries, surprises, and adorable aquatic friends.

Über die Autorin bzw. den Autor: John Hare is a freelance illustrator and graphic designer. His first book for children, Field Trip to the Moon, was a Golden Duck Notable Picture Book and an ALA Notable Picture Book. Its companion books are Field Trip to the Ocean Deep, also a Golden Duck Notable Picture Book, and Field Trip to Volcano Island, a Junior Library Guild Gold Standard Selection.
